Download electron launches “virginia is for launch lovers”

Duration: (4:11) 2025-02-04T14:28:34+00:00



electron launches “virginia is for launch lovers” electron launches “virginia is for launch lovers” electron launches “virginia is for launch lovers”

Description
Download this and online watch electron launches “virginia is for launch lovers”
Related videos

Mxtube.net